How It Works

This isn’t a classroom—it’s a launch pad.

Minipreneur 5.0 is a hands-on, high-energy, confidence-building adventure that blends real-world business skills with kid-level fun. Each week brings fresh challenges, wild creativity, and small wins that add up to something huge by the final event.

Here’s how we build it together:

  • 5 Weekly Sessions (1.5 hours each)
    Each session builds toward launch day—from business idea to product design, branding to customer pitch. Sessions are fast-paced, collaborative, and designed to meet kids where they are.

  • Gamified Weekly Challenges
    From slogan sprints, logo remix battles, and friendly peer to peer Shark Tank, our weekly activities are mini marketing Olympics. Students earn badge stickers for creativity, collaboration, and follow-through—building pride and motivation as they go.

  • Money, Made Fun
    Kids learn to price their items, make change, track profits, and plan how to save or reinvest their earnings. We use real-world math in a way that feels like a money superpower.

  • Creative Business Tools
    From poster boards and signage kits, and income and savings goals sheets, we provide age-appropriate, design-forward tools to help students feel legit and look the part.

  • Mentorship Moments + Pep Talks
    Every session includes space for sharing wins, talking through challenges, and hearing from special guest speakers—including returning Minipreneurs and community entrepreneurs, public personalities, and local officials.

  • Finale Event: The Big Day
    It all leads to one incredible night: a highly attended outdoor Maker’s Fair + Food Truck Festival, with booths, music, media coverage, and hundreds of customers. This is where kids see their ideas come to life—and walk away with real earnings, real pride, and real experience.

What Your Child Will Learn

  • Creative brainstorming + business ideation

  • Branding, signage, and marketing

  • Money basics: cost vs profit, sales tracking, reinvestment

  • Customer service and real-world soft skills

  • Resilience, confidence, and pride in their unique voice
